- Where can I buy crutches today in Mayfield, OH?
- A pharmacy is usually the fastest option. 2 are listed on this page. Most retail pharmacies keep basic aluminum underarm crutches in stock for roughly $25 to $45 and do not need a prescription. Call first, because crutches are a low-turnover item and a single store may be out.
- Do I need a prescription to buy crutches in Ohio?
- No. Crutches are sold over the counter, and anyone can walk in and buy a pair. A prescription only matters if you want Medicare or private insurance to pay for them, in which case the supplier also has to be enrolled in Medicare and you need a written order from your clinician.
